Description

A building and construction contract must fulfill the same requirements as any other type of contract in regard to matters such as offer and acceptance, sufficiency of consideration, certainty, and the like. Such a contract generally provides not only for the construction of the project, but also for many matters that are incidental to the project. Thus, it may provide for the carrying of liability, workers' compensation, and fire insurance policies, designating which party is responsible for obtaining particular insurance. A building and construction contract will typically specify the duties, responsibilities, and liabilities of each of the parties, as well as those of any employed architect or engineer. The amount and method of compensation is, of course, an important part of such a contract.

The rules of construction in a Maine Construction Contract for New Residential Dwelling involve interpreting the contract's terms to ascertain the parties' intentions. This includes considering the plain meaning of words, the relationship of the parties, and the contract's overall purpose. Ambiguities may often be resolved in favor of the party that did not draft the contract. Clear language and detailed descriptions help ensure better understanding and fewer disputes.
